A Meiji-era-adjacent house in Nagoya's Moriyama ward, still hand-crafting koji and yamahai sake 160 years after its 'Tatsuta-ya' beginnings.
Toharu Shuzo was founded in 1865 by Tobei Sato under the shop name 'Tatsuta-ya' in Moriyama, Nagoya. The brewery and its flagship brand, Azumaryu ('East Dragon'), take their name from the founder's given name 'Azuma' and the shop's 'Ryu' (dragon). More than a century and a half later, the kura still practices yamahai fermentation and hand-made koji, holding to older methods of brewing.
